Job Title: Senior Full Stack Engineer (Level 3)

Location: Dublin, OH

Type: Hybrid (2 days work from home)

Salary: $150,000 + 6.5% bonus

Job Summary:

A Senior Full Stack Engineer is a proficient full-stack developer working in an Agile environment, contributing hands-on to deliver technology solutions that transform healthcare into a safer and more cost-effective industry.
